New healthy food options featuring fresh produce are now appearing at the cash register of Peet's Coffee and Tea in 126 Northern California stores, including the Bay Area, Sacramento, Monterey, Santa Cruz and Capitola. They are made and delivered fresh every day to Peet's stores.



Super Greens and Kale Salad, Black Lentil Salad, Quinoa Salad, Fruit Bowl, Cheese and Fruit Box, and Hummus & Carrots are some of the new offerings.anuk030514We have seen something similar with Starbucks, in its fresh cut fruit and prepared food options.

"Our Peet’s fans have asked and we’ve answered with our new fresh salads and sandwiches. This gives them a more complete Peet’s experience with a menu of healthy, delicious food that is house made locally here in the Bay Area and delivered fresh to our stores every day," said Dave Burwick, President and CEO of Peet’s Coffee & Tea. "Plus, we’ve added vegetarian, vegan and gluten-free items which we know are important options to many of our fans in Northern California."anuk030514

The menu was developed in collaboration with Bay Area Chef Arnold Eric Wong along with his local bakery Raison D’être.anuk030514“I’m thrilled to be working with Peet’s Coffee & Tea as they share my deep passion to quality, freshness and using the finest ingredients. And, it’s important that we give Peet’s fans a locally sourced, artisanal food experience that matches the quality of their coffee,” said Chef Arnold Wong. “We have carefully crafted these recipes to be health conscious and flavorful, and are making them locally right here in the kitchen at Raison D’être.”
